HOW TO SELECT METAL OXIDE VARISTORS
• What is the range of ACrms or DC Voltage in the application?
• How will the varistor be connected in the circuit?
• Calculate the required varistor voltage at 10% to 25% above the system RMS or DC Voltage.
• Calculate the varistor energy rating needed based on energy in transient voltage.
• Calculate the surge current wave form from the surge voltage and surge impedance.
• Check to make sure the withstanding surge current of the varistor is sufficient.
